So my friend found an old (still sealed) Yankee Brewer "burch's pale ale" kit in their house.

The Best by date on the yeast packet is may of 1997. Liquid malt extract feels fine...


Think I could just pick up a new packet-o-yeast (All I have in the fridge is 1116/1118 and red star blanc) and give it a try?

Or just toss it?
 
Extract usually doesn't age well and the yeast are most likely way past their prime. Make sure that you make a starter a few days before brewday and step up the population a few times if you intend to use it. I would be the extract wont taste very good.
